(August 15, 2016) -- Chip Lutz continued his impressive play of late, as he made the cut at the
U.S. Senior Open. Fresh off this third British Senior Amateur title Lutz was the lone amateur of 23 to make the cut at Scioto Country Club.
The Junior PGA Championship, played at Wannamoisett Country Club, concluded on Friday and it was Norman Xiong and Lucy Li taking home their respective titles.
REGIONAL NEWS
In the Tennessee State Amateur, Wes Gosselin won in historic fashion while Tyler McArdell won the New York State Amateur in comeback style.
At the Florida Senior Open amateur Michael Weeks won against a talented professional field.
Out in the great northwest, Chase Carlson captured the Washington State Amateur on the sixth playoff hole.
Allyson Geer repeated at the Michigan Women's Amateur.
INTERNATIONAL NEWS
In Canada Hugo Bernard rallied and won the Canadian Amateur while Falko Hanisch won the British Boys' Amateur.
